Paulette Szalay, 60, dieted for nearly all her life. But it took a mindset change for her to lose the weight that was slowing her down and affecting her health.
“That pivotal moment was on Easter Sunday of 2022. I was close to 260 pounds. I was an educator, working on the second floor, and I could no longer walk up and down the stairs. I had to take the elevator,” she tells TODAY.”
Her weight contributed to a host of medical conditions: High blood pressure , high cholesterol, swollen legs from retaining fluid, acid reflux and thyroid issues.
I had the mentality that I couldn’t lose weight after menopause, and that this was the way I was going to be for the rest of my life.
